, Chapter 2 political and economic environment

Free trade

Free international business benefits form the free movement of goods and services.
Therefore, consumers have a wider choice of products.
Competition between imported and local products pushes prices down and the quality up.

Regional trading arrangements

The objective of a regional trading arrangement is to reduce trade barries among the
member countries.
The most common forms of cooperation are:
1. Free-trade bloc
2. Customs union
3. Common market

Free-trade bloc
Countries strive for free trade because this form of trade offers a number of advantages:
1. Efficient use of productions factors
2. Stimulation of competition
3. Prevention of trade wars
4. Promotion of trade and investment
5. Promotion of welfare

Examples of regional integration agreements are the European Free Trade Association
(EFTA). And the North American Free Trade Agreement (NAFTA).

Customs union
A customs union exits when two or more countries abolish all mutual tariffs. Besides mutual
free trade, the participating countries have a joint external tariff; that is to say, with respect
to non-member countries the same import duties are levied.
The problem of the final destination of imported goods is non-existent in this case, because
the participating countries levy the same tariff for non-member countries.

Common market

The EU is an example of the common market. All products from the EU are exempt from
import duties. Outside the EU, import duties do apply.
